Leverage Impact Modeling

Impact

Leverage Impact Modeling, within the context of cryptocurrency derivatives, options trading, and financial derivatives, represents a quantitative framework designed to assess the cascading effects of leverage across interconnected market participants and instruments. It moves beyond traditional risk assessments by explicitly incorporating the potential for systemic amplification arising from correlated positions and margin calls. This modeling approach is particularly crucial in decentralized finance (DeFi) environments where leverage is often readily accessible and counterparty risk can be less transparent. Understanding these impacts is essential for regulatory bodies, exchanges, and individual traders seeking to mitigate potential destabilization events.
